The Role of Variable Ratio Reinforcement
A key element driving engagement is the use of variable ratio reinforcement. This means that rewards – successful crossings – aren't predictable. Sometimes a gap appears quickly, other times players must wait longer. This unpredictability keeps players hooked, as they anticipate the next opportunity to earn a reward. This is the same principle that makes slot machines so addictive; the intermittent reinforcement creates a compelling loop of anticipation and reward. The inherent randomness prevents players from becoming complacent, maintaining a consistent level of engagement and excitement.
